UA Ruhr Early Career Researchers Board
The University Alliance Ruhr (UA Ruhr) has set another example for the support of researchers in early career phases with the establishment of an Early Career Researchers Board (ECR Board for short) in 2025.

The joint committee strengthens the perspective of early-career researchers in the structural development of the UA Ruhr. It is an important tool for creating excellent conditions for researchers within the network. Its regular tasks include reviewing joint funding measures such as the UA Ruhr Mobility Grants and the UA Ruhr Proposal Writing Grants.
Each university has nominated three members from different career stages and disciplines. The ECR Board members are:

The committee is coordinated by the Research Academy, which is responsible within the UA Ruhr for supporting researchers on their career paths within and beyond academic research.
